How to Make iPhone Screen Stay On
Keeping your iPhone screen from going dark can be a lifesaver during presentations, reading sessions, or those moments when you’re following a recipe. To make your iPhone screen stay on, you simply need to adjust the Auto-Lock settings. This quick tweak will let you control how long your screen remains active without any interaction.

Adjusting your iPhone’s Auto-Lock settings is straightforward. This guide will walk you through the process step by step, making it easy to keep your screen lit for as long as you need.
Step 1: Open Settings
First, unlock your iPhone and locate the "Settings" app on your home screen.
This app is your gateway to customizing your device. It’s where you can tweak everything from notifications to privacy settings. You’ll find it represented by a gray gear icon.
Step 2: Tap on Display & Brightness
Next, scroll down until you find "Display & Brightness."
This section controls how your iPhone screen looks and behaves. Here, you can adjust brightness levels and, most importantly, the Auto-Lock feature.
Step 3: Select Auto-Lock
Tap on "Auto-Lock" to view the available options.
This setting determines how long your screen will stay on when it’s idle. Choose the option that best suits your needs. The longer the time, the longer your screen will stay awake.
Step 4: Choose Your Preferred Time
Choose a time option that suits your needs, such as 5 minutes or "Never."
If you select "Never," your screen will stay on indefinitely until you manually lock it. This is ideal for presenting or following instructions without interruptions.
Step 5: Exit Settings
Press the Home button or swipe up (on newer models) to exit Settings.
You’ve now successfully adjusted your screen settings. Your iPhone will remember your choice and keep the screen on as per your preference.
After these steps, your iPhone screen will stay on for the time you selected. It’s a great way to ensure uninterrupted access to your device without needing to constantly tap the screen to keep it awake.

Frequently Asked Questions
Why does my iPhone screen turn off so quickly?
This happens because of the Auto-Lock setting, which you can adjust in the Display & Brightness section of the Settings app.
Will keeping my screen on drain the battery?
Yes, a longer screen-on time can drain the battery more quickly. Adjust brightness to mitigate this.
Can I make the screen stay on for specific apps?
You can use Guided Access to keep the screen on while using a particular app.
How do I manually lock my iPhone?
Press the side button or the top button (depending on your model) to lock your iPhone.
Is there a shortcut to adjust Auto-Lock settings?
Currently, there is no shortcut. You need to navigate through Settings to make adjustments.
